Ever wish someone would just explain philosophy in a way that actually connects to your real life? That's Philosophy for Lunch.Hosted by Shawn and Claire Spainhour, Philosophy for Lunch is a weekly podcast that makes the great ideas of philosophy, psychology, and the history of thought genuinely accessible — without dumbing them down. Each episode runs 25 to 35 minutes: long enough to go deep, short enough for a lunch break, a commute, or the end of your day.From Stoicism and Marcus Aurelius to Anna Freud's defense mechanisms, from Gödel's incompleteness theorems to the trolley problem — Shawn and Claire explore the ideas that matter most for understanding yourself, other people, and the world. No prior knowledge required. No lectures. Just two curious people thinking out loud together.If you enjoy Philosophize This!, The Partially Examined Life, or Hidden Brain — and want something warmer, shorter, and built around genuine conversation — this show is for you.New episodes every Sunday.
